How they compare

Mozambique currently reports 0.1899 °C against 0.1895 °C in East Timor, a difference of 0.0004 °C.

The two have swapped places 4 times across 8 shared years of data; in 1940 it was Mozambique ahead.

Mozambique ranks 135th and East Timor ranks 136th of 193 countries.

Across the 8 decades both report, Mozambique averaged higher in 4 and East Timor in 4.

Head to head by decade

Decade Mozambique East Timor Difference Ahead
1940s -0.3786 °C -0.7448 °C 0.3662 °C Mozambique
1950s -0.4776 °C -0.4908 °C 0.0132 °C Mozambique
1960s -0.6143 °C -0.5785 °C 0.0358 °C East Timor
1970s -0.65 °C -0.4139 °C 0.2361 °C East Timor
1980s -0.4664 °C -0.1145 °C 0.3519 °C East Timor
1990s -0.1652 °C -0.1764 °C 0.0112 °C Mozambique
2000s -0.0914 °C -0.0754 °C 0.016 °C East Timor
2010s 0.1899 °C 0.1895 °C 0.0004 °C Mozambique

Averages of every year both report within each decade.
